Market position

This sits squarely in the budget bracket, but don't read that as worthless - the Huntsman Collection provenance and the Restricted rarity give it a reliable base. It moves in a thin-market way: plenty of interest at sensible levels, but only a handful of buyers act when supply gets picky. For a seller that means steady exits if you price around the floor and flag the right wear.

How the wear ladder is priced

The ladder is capped and stepped rather than a smooth glide; value clusters rather than trickles. You get a clear separation between the cleaner copies and the rest, with each step holding its own bid level. Expect discrete jumps as you cross the top wear bands rather than a gentle slope.

Buy vs sell spread

Listings often sit above the practical cashout because buyers build in margin and patience; the thin-market profile widens that gap. Sellers must price to the net band if they want an immediate exit, not the inflated ask. Factor in that the Huntsman Weapon Case provenance draws collectors who list higher and buyers who wait.

The clean-end premium

The top wear commands multiples above the mid ladder - those pristine red finishes are where value congregates. Clean copies catch collectors who want the designer's custom paint job and the strongest visual pop. Few sellers hold many clean ones, so expect concentrated demand when a true clean appears.

Capped float range

Because the finish is capped, the lowest-wear copies are cleaner than the usual worsts, compressing the bottom of the ladder. That makes the mid wears behave more like usable game skins instead of trash. The result: fewer ultra-worn bargains and a tighter lower tail.

The StatTrak line

StatTrak exists and trades on its own rhythm; the ST lane amplifies interest from collectors and duel buyers. The premium is sizable and not linear - some StatTrak steps outpace the non-ST equivalents. For cashing out, separate listings and expectations for StatTrak; they do not clear at the same speed as regular copies.

Look and palette

This is a red-forward skin with a custom paint job by not_from_Heaven, so it reads hot and aggressive in match play. The saturated red pops on the shotgun silhouette, and the finish holds up under movement and fire. Designers like not_from_Heaven tend to attract repeat buyers who know the visual language.

The longer arc

The yearly trend pushed the skin up hard before a recent pull that went down hard over the short term; overall it has stronger footing than a random budget piece. That re-rating earlier has left a sturdier floor even as short-term interest cooled. Watch for renewed bids when the broader Huntsman Collection turns up in meta chatter.

Common pricing mistakes

Traders often list by sticker price instead of the net cashout band, or they ignore the capped float and label a mid-wear as a clean. Mis-tagging StatTrak copies under regular listings is another frequent trap. Avoid these by double-checking float and variant, and by pricing to the live sell band, not the highest ask.

Community standing

Among players this is a liked but niche pickup - a practical red shotgun with collector appeal rather than a headline grail. The pro players linked to the design add a nod of recognition, but the skin stays within a tight community of buyers. That translates to reliable, if selective, demand.
